United Club Denver location and hours

The United Club at Denver International Airport has three locations, all in Concourse B. The first is the West Wing, which is airside and adjacent to Gate B32. It is open daily from 4:30 a.m. to 9:30 p.m. The second location is the East Wing, which is also airside, adjacent to Gate B44, but it is currently closed. The third option is a pop-up location near Gate B59, open daily from 7 a.m. to 9:30 p.m.

The United Club offers a range of amenities, including drinks and snacks, WiFi, fax machines, conference facilities, and comfortable seating. One-time passes can be purchased through the United App for $59 per person, and you must provide a same-day boarding pass for United Airlines, Star Alliance, or a partner-operated flight. Annual memberships are also available for $650 or 85,000 miles. The club features locally-inspired food, such as oatmeal with Colorado honey and a Denver-style egg frittata, and its decor showcases the work of local artists, including a mural by Jaime Molina and Pedro Barrios that captures the essence of Denver through street art-inspired geometric shapes.

Art and decor

The United Club at Denver Airport features a variety of art and decor elements that showcase local talent and reflect the culture and beauty of Denver and Colorado. The club's design concept draws inspiration from a ski lodge, creating a cosy and inviting atmosphere for travellers. With a focus on showcasing local artists and celebrating the spirit of the Mile High City, the art and decor in the United Club enhance the overall experience for guests seeking comfort and relaxation during their layovers.

Upon entering the club, guests are greeted by a striking sculpture by artist Will Schlough. This unique piece, inspired by the cones of the Colorado Blue Spruce, is crafted from dozens of repurposed skateboards, adding a touch of creativity and sustainability to the space. The entryway sets the tone for the rest of the club, where original artwork and thoughtful decor are seamlessly integrated throughout.

One of the notable features of the club is the custom artwork specifically created for the space by local artists. A sculptural installation by Colorado-based artist Amy Hoagland uses glass rods to form a topographic-inspired piece that creates an optical illusion from different vantage points. This three-dimensional work adds depth and intrigue to the environment. Additionally, a custom mural by Denver-based multidisciplinary designer Adam Vicarel, titled "Come Fly With Us," showcases a vibrant blend of colours and shapes that capture the essence of travel and the beauty of the Colorado landscape.

The United Club also showcases a diverse range of artistic mediums, including photography, paintings, and murals. One such mural, created by local artists Jaime Molina and Pedro Barrios, is a vibrant street art-inspired piece that tells the story of Denver through geometric shapes. The club also displays a trio of prints by Indigenous artist Danielle SeeWalker, who highlights her cultural heritage through captivating imagery. Each piece of art within the club not only enhances the aesthetic appeal but also provides a sense of connection to the local community and its talented artists.

The decor of the United Club complements the artwork and reflects the ski lodge theme. Comfortable seating, stacked wood, and flannel-patterned cushions create a cosy and inviting atmosphere. The club also features two fireplace lounges, further enhancing the feeling of warmth and relaxation. The game lounge offers a more interactive experience with shuffleboard tables, providing a space for guests to socialise and unwind.
